About The Position

The Analytical Lab Technician II on the Quality & Analytical team will provide technical support with a focus on experiments and methods of analysis that are well understood and normally have standard procedures to follow. This role involves setting up and performing routine QC and analytical testing, supporting product development and commercial production testing, performing accurate calculations, making detailed observations, and maintaining up-to-date working records. The position requires maintaining a clean and safe laboratory environment, adhering to legislation, and demonstrating corporate values. The role involves interaction with internal teams such as Joint Health and Safety Committee, Product Development Chemistry, Research, Biology, Application Science, and Process, as well as external interactions with Service Providers and Suppliers.

Responsibilities

  • Perform routine analytical testing of pesticide formulations, raw materials, and in-process samples in accordance with established SOPs and recognized industry methods, including CIPAC, FAO, and EPA guidelines.
  • Prepare samples and solutions required for analytical testing and laboratory operations.
  • Generate reliable analytical results through accurate execution of test methods and calculations.
  • Maintain complete, accurate, and up-to-date laboratory records by entering, uploading, reviewing, organizing, and summarizing analytical data, observations, and results in laboratory notebooks, databases, and reporting systems.
  • Demonstrate a high level of attention to detail by documenting observations, identifying anomalies, and ensuring the traceability and quality of analytical data.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e laboratory environment through routine housekeeping, equipment cleaning, and proper management of laboratory materials and waste.
  • Safely handle laboratory samples and materials, including the routine lifting, carrying, shaking, pouring, and cleaning of containers weighing up to 10 kg.
  • Assist in receiving, labeling, storing, and shipping laboratory samples and materials as required.
  • Follow all laboratory safety procedures, company policies, and applicable regulatory requirements.
  • Support continuous improvement activities by assisting with method optimization, troubleshooting, and other laboratory initiatives as directed.
